All you need is a Bic lighter, your idea for a brand, and this Instructable.
Here are the main points to give you an idea of what to expect:
- have a Bic lighter ready
- choose your image
- reverse your image using Autodesk Pixlr (no need to explain why you have to do this, right?)
- upload your image to Shapeways.
That last bit is the “tricky” part – not because you have to create the branding iron yourself. It’s exactly the opposite. Shapeways is a service that will take your design and will 3D print your design using stainless steel.
